Just a Data Science Bill, Sitting Here on Capital Hill | Stats + Stories Episode 296
Sep 21, 2023
The podcast discusses a bill in the U.S. Congress to improve stats education. Guests Donna LaLonde and Steve Pierson talk about the importance of data literacy education and workforce diversity. They also share insights on finding co-sponsors for the bill and the challenges in teaching statistics and data science. The podcast highlights the bipartisan support for data science and literacy education while acknowledging the funding and opposition challenges.

The Data Science Education Bill aims to support schools, teachers, and educators in implementing data literacy education.
The bill focuses on providing professional development, curriculum, and general support to schools interested in data science and statistics education.
